DESCRIPTION
Amazon is looking for a talented Vendor Manager to join the Tools team. The Vendor Manager will work with highly strategic vendors to drive a large business towards the next phase of growth and will own all aspects of their business. He/she will use data to identify any operational, logistical or business issues, negotiate on Amazon's behalf and cultivate key brands for further growth. The successful VM will build strong relationships with senior stakeholders, drive significant top and bottom line results, and manage multiple responsibilities within a fast-paced environment. The candidate must also possess strong acumen and be comfortable drawing metric-based conclusions by managing an extensive amount of data. This person needs to have a deep curiosity about how things work, and a passion for creating a world class shopping experience for our customers.
In addition, the Vendor Manager must have strong influencing and communicator skills so as to work effectively with Amazon internal groups such as in-stock management, site merchandising, advertising, finance, operations, and retail systems. The successful candidate should be able to define and drive long-term objectives and strategy for the business. He/she will be responsible for managing comprehensive selection across multiple large brands, developing collaborative marketing and promotions, and driving sales and margin improvements. Proven project management skills, attention to detail, negotiation skills and organizational skills are musts.
